OREM, Utah – A suspect was briefly arrested and afterward released following a reported attack on conservative activist Charlie Kirk at Utah Valley University on September 10, 2025. The Federal Bureau of Inquiry (FBI) is continuing its investigation.

Evidence Gathering and university Response
The Utah State Police, through Public Security Commissioner beau Mason, reported that initial evidence is being gathered from campus security cameras. This footage is currently under analysis to aid in identifying the suspect and establishing the sequence of events.
Utah Valley University has acknowledged the incident and is cooperating with law enforcement. Further details regarding the university’s response and any potential impact on campus safety are expected to be released soon.
